Heavy Traffic Expected Tomorrow Due to Strike, Also Many Rental Cars on the Road

Summary by Algemeen Dagblad
Rijkswaterstaat is calling on road users to avoid rush hour on Tuesday where possible. Due to the national strike by NS staff, the road authority expects a busier morning and evening rush hour than normal.

Due to the strike by NS staff, buses and trains of regional carriers may be extra busy on Tuesday. A number of these carriers are warning of this via their website or social media.
